0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

基于SDWAN的智能选路技术实现

夽谷科技组网服务 来源: 夽谷科技组网服务 作者: 夽谷科技组网服务 2022-10-13 09:22 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

基于SDWAN《夽易联》的智能选路技术实现

RIR应用于SDWAN场景示意图

poYBAGNHaBKAIR79AAFWqod5ytw933.png

业务流量模板

业务流量模板用于为一类业务流量定义选路策略,通过Flow ID(转发ID)标识。

设备可以为标识为Flow ID的业务流量选择其对应的业务流量模板,并基于业务流量模板下配置的选路策略进行选路。

目前支持通过QoS重标记功能为流量标识Flow ID。当接口收到业务流量报文时,设备会根据流量报文五元组区别业务特征,为业务流量标识其相应业务流量模板的Flow ID。该业务流量标识仅在设备选路流程中使用,不会被报文携带出去。

链路

SDWAN《夽易联》组网中的链路是SDWAN隧道,在两个CPE之间则是一条TTE(Transport Tunnel Endpoint,传输隧道终结点)连接。每条SDWAN隧道连接一个传输网络,通过传输网络名称可以唯一标识一条SDWAN隧道。智能选路通过SDWAN隧道使用的传输网络名称区分不同的链路。如下图所示,RR通过TN 1和TN 2分别建立了一条到CPE的SDWAN隧道。

SDWAN中的链路

poYBAGNHaB-AfRwTAAB5b3p_4jk900.png

基于链路优先级选路

链路优先级

对于某一业务类型流量,用户可以根据链路特征、业务需求等因素,如链路价格,为其可选链路定义优先级。设备为业务流量选路时,会优先选择优先级较高的链路。

基于SDWAN隧道部署智能选路时,可以在业务流量模板下基于传输网络名称,为SDWAN隧道配置链路优先级。

优先级策略

在同一业务流量模板下可以为不同的链路配置相同的链路优先级。

设备为某业务流量选路时,会按照业务流量模板下配置的链路优先级从高到低的顺序,依次选路:

· 如果该优先级下没有链路符合业务要求,则继续选择次一优先级下的链路。

· 如果该优先级下有且只有一条链路符合业务要求,则选择该链路进行传输。

· 如果该优先级下有两条及以上的链路符合业务要求,则按照智能选路负载分担方式选择链路。

质量评估机制和质量策略

SLA

SLA(Service Level Agreement,服务等级协议)用来区分不同业务对链路质量的差异化需求。SLA中定义了用于评估链路质量的各类阈值,包括延迟、抖动、丢包率等。智能选路基于SLA实现业务流量的质量策略,即用户可以为不同的业务流量指定具有不同SLA要求的质量策略。

基于链路带宽选路

通过基于链路带宽选路,不仅可以为业务流量选择带宽符合要求的链路,还可以均衡地使用各链路带宽,尽量避免出现个别链路带宽占用过高,甚至链路拥塞的情况。

链路带宽

基于链路带宽选路时,设备会根据可选链路和所属物理接口的已使用带宽、链路总带宽以及会话预计使用的带宽等多个方面为业务流量选择合适的链路。链路带宽是Tunnel接口带宽,而链路所属物理接口带宽则是发送隧道报文的物理出接口带宽。

同时,设备以会话为最小粒度,而非业务类型,进行基于链路带宽的选路,以实现更精细的链路带宽管理。会话通过五元组唯一定义,报文的源IP地址、目的IP地址、源端口、目的端口以及传输层协议中任一元素不同,则属于不同的会话。

带宽策略

为某个会话的流量进行智能选路时,设备会实时获取会话预计使用的带宽,并基于获取的带宽进行带宽检测;如果获取不到,则采用手工配置的会话预计使用的带宽进行带宽检测。如果同时满足以下条件,则认为待选链路当前可用带宽符合会话带宽要求,带宽检测通过:

· 待选链路所属物理接口的已使用带宽与会话预计使用的带宽之和小于待选链路所属物理接口总带宽的80%;

· 待选链路已使用带宽与会话预计使用的带宽之和小于待选链路总带宽的80%。

属于相同业务类型的不同会话使用同一选路策略时,选路结果可能不同。

负载分担

当某一业务流量存在多条链路可选时,设备会基于链路带宽将业务流量的不同会话分布到多条链路上传输,以实现链路的负载分担。智能选路支持多种链路负载分担模式,包括:

· 逐流加权选路模式:RIR全局级的链路负载分担模式,对参与智能选路的所有业务流量生效。该模式可以按照一定权重将同一业务流量的不同会话分布到不同链路上进行传输,一个会话只选择一条链路进行传输。

· 逐流周期调整模式:RIR全局级的链路负载分担模式,对参与智能选路的所有业务流量生效。该模式不但可以将同一业务流量的不同会话分布到不同链路上进行传输,而且会进行周期性地调整。在一个调整周期内,一个会话只选择一条链路进行传输。

· 逐包模式:业务级的链路负载分担模式,只对参与智能选路的指定业务流量生效。该模式可以将指定业务流量的同一会话分布到多条链路上进行传输。

逐包链路负载分担模式的优先级高于逐流链路负载分担模式。

审核编辑 黄昊宇

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• sdwan
    +关注

    关注

    2

    文章

    238

    浏览量

    7912
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    企业选择SDWAN方案时,需要注意哪些?

    ##企业选择SDWAN方案时,需要注意哪些?在数字化转型浪潮中,企业广域网正经历从“连通即可”向“智能、安全、云原生”的深刻变革。SD-WAN技术凭借其颠覆性的架构理念,成为企业优化网络性能
    的头像 发表于 08-15 10:03 1302次阅读
    企业选择<b class='flag-5'>SDWAN</b>方案时,需要注意哪些?

    中宇联SDWAN:重塑企业网络智能连接新纪元

    拥抱数字化转型浪潮,企业网络架构正面临连接敏捷性、成本压力与安全威胁的三重挑战。中宇联SDWAN解决方案正在深刻改变企业广域网的构建逻辑,其核心在于以软件定义技术重构传统网络架构,将原本僵硬、高成本
    的头像 发表于 07-16 17:56 699次阅读

    Path Bandwidth Extended Community:藏在BGP属性里的智能路由革命

    传统BGP协议虽能实现路由可达性,但缺乏对路径质量的动态感知能力,导致流量分配不均、高延迟链未被规避等问题。为提升网络资源利用率,动态智能
    的头像 发表于 06-24 14:00 612次阅读
    Path Bandwidth Extended Community:藏在BGP属性里的<b class='flag-5'>智能</b>路由革命

    动态感知+智能决策,一文解读 AI 场景组网下的动态智能技术

    人工智能(AI),特别是大规模模型训练和推理,正以前所未有的方式重塑数据中心网络。传统的“尽力而为”网络架构,在处理海量、突发的AI数据洪流时捉襟见肘。AI模型对网络性能的严苛要求——高带宽、低延迟
    的头像 发表于 06-20 15:01 1313次阅读
    动态感知+<b class='flag-5'>智能</b>决策,一文解读 AI 场景组网下的动态<b class='flag-5'>智能</b><b class='flag-5'>选</b><b class='flag-5'>路</b><b class='flag-5'>技术</b>

    智算网络路径质量三要素:带宽/队列/时延在智能中的协同优化

    为了从根本上优化AI流量的传输效率并最大化集群利用率,我们设计并实践了基于多维度网络状态感知的动态智能技术。该技术的核心创新在于,聚焦关
    的头像 发表于 06-13 15:44 565次阅读
    智算网络路径质量三要素:带宽/队列/时延在<b class='flag-5'>智能</b><b class='flag-5'>选</b><b class='flag-5'>路</b>中的协同优化

    FP7195:双调光如何重塑智能照明行业?

    随着LED照明技术的快速发展和智能照明需求的激增,双调光技术正成为照明行业的重要发展方向。传统单调光方案只能
    的头像 发表于 04-11 14:11 680次阅读
    FP7195:双<b class='flag-5'>路</b>调光如何重塑<b class='flag-5'>智能</b>照明行业?

    智慧路灯杆如何实现协同辅助自动驾驶?

    随着科技的飞速发展,自动驾驶技术逐渐从科幻走向现实,而车协同作为实现高级别自动驾驶的关键支撑,正受到越来越多的关注。在车协同系统中,智慧路灯杆凭借其独特的优势,成为了不可或缺的一环
    的头像 发表于 04-09 20:53 648次阅读

    74AVC1T8832单双电源转换2输入或带通规格书

    电子发烧友网站提供《74AVC1T8832单双电源转换2输入或带通规格书.pdf》资料免费下载
    发表于 02-18 16:20 0次下载
    74AVC1T8832单<b class='flag-5'>路</b>双电源转换2输入或带<b class='flag-5'>选</b>通规格书

    ADS1281有无片信号,想用一根总线连接16ADS1281,通过片控制其工作,可以吗?

    ADS1281有无片信号,我想用一根总线连接16ADS1281,通过片控制其工作,可以吗?哪个引脚可以用作片?如果不可以的话可以用16位I2C和SMBUS低功耗I/O扩展器作
    发表于 02-10 07:04

    想用一根总线连接16ADS1281,通过片控制其工作,可以吗?

    ADS1281有无片信号,我想用一根总线连接16ADS1281,通过片控制其工作,可以吗?哪个引脚可以用作片?如果不可以的话可以用16位I2C和SMBUS低功耗I/O扩展器作
    发表于 02-10 06:02

    云协同如何让Robotaxi加速实现

    随着人工智能、大数据、车联网等技术的深度融合,智能驾驶技术正在迈入快速发展的关键阶段。作为高级别自动驾驶的典型应用场景,Robotaxi通过其车
    的头像 发表于 01-12 11:49 1359次阅读
    车<b class='flag-5'>路</b>云协同如何让Robotaxi加速<b class='flag-5'>实现</b>

    【「嵌入式系统设计与实现」阅读体验】+ 智能晾衣架

    嵌入式系统设计与实现,封面如下图所示。 分享一下关于3.5章节,智能晾衣架的阅读体验, 在我看到标题时,理解的智能晾衣架的大致模型为带一些传感器的可升降晾衣架。 阅读之后发现智能晾衣架
    发表于 12-30 18:06

    24电磁锁主板在智能存储系统中的作用

    在无人值守场景中,如自助服务机、智能生鲜柜、共享储物柜等,使用24电磁锁主板可以集成身份识别技术,将用户的验证结果转化为相应的开锁动作,提升用户体验和运营效率,是实现
    的头像 发表于 12-30 14:20 935次阅读
    24<b class='flag-5'>路</b>电磁锁主板在<b class='flag-5'>智能</b>存储系统中的作用

    请问单SPI总线能否通过多路片信号去控制多路ADS1247?

    求助:单SPI总线能否通过多路片信号去控制多路ADS1247,谢谢!
    发表于 12-23 07:42

    在不降低16k的速率条件下,ADS8681能否实现模拟信号的交替采集?

    ADS8681芯片+通器(型号为TS5A3160DBVR)以16K的采样速率对两模拟信号进行交替采样时发现两个通道的数据出现互相干扰,经测试发现通器切换通道后需要等待90μs以上ADC芯片
    发表于 12-09 06:20